Sachin Tendulkar’s guard fatally shoots himself in Maharashtra

A man who worked as the security guard of global cricket icon Sachin Tendulkar, has allegedly shot himself to death on Wednesday. As per reports, the incident took place in Jamner in Maharashtra’s Jalgaon district at 1:30 am.

The deceased was identified as Prakash Kapde, 39, a State Reserve Police Force jawan. Kapde was assigned to protect Tendulkar. As per Hindustan Times, the 39-year-old used his service gun to take his own life while visiting his hometown. Kapde shot himself in the neck.

While the motive behind the alleged suicide remains unclear so far, an investigation is underway to find the reasons behind the jawan’s actions.

Meanwhile, Kapde’s body has been sent for a postmortem examination.

Jamner Police has filed an accidental death report. Police are also quizzing relatives, close aides and colleagues of the deceased to ascertain the reason of his death.

The deceased is survived by his wife, two young children, elderly parents, a brother, and other relatives.
